Immerse yourself in the epic and enchanting world of "Le amazzoni - Le guerriere dal seno nudo" by the renowned Italian composer Riz Ortolani. Released in 1973, this album is a captivating journey through a symphonic soundscape that brings to life the legendary tale of the Amazonian warriors. With a runtime of 1 hour and 8 minutes, this album is a testament to Ortolani's mastery of orchestration and his ability to evoke vivid imagery through music.
The album features a variety of tracks, each offering a unique perspective on the mythical Amazons. From the powerful and dramatic "La battaglia delle amazzoni" to the serene and reflective "All'ombra dei cedri," Ortolani's compositions are as diverse as they are compelling. The album also includes several versions of key tracks, allowing for a deeper exploration of the musical themes and motifs.
Riz Ortolani, known for his work in film scores, brings his cinematic flair to this album, creating a rich and immersive listening experience.
